The Dodge Coronet is an automobile that was marketed by Dodge in seven generations, and shared nameplates with the same bodyshell with varying levels of equipment installed. Introduced as a full-size car in 1949, it was the division's highest trim line and moved to the lowest level starting in 1955 through 1959. The 1968 Dodge Coronet R/T is scarcely remembered among historic muscle cars, with legendary models like the Ford Mustang, Pontiac GTO, Plymouth Superbird, and a few more taking up all the limelight.But, shifting it towards the Coronet R/T for just a second reveals how special it actually is. With great looks and two powerful V8 alternatives, the 1968 Dodge Coronet R/T is a purebred classic.

Q: What is the length of the 1968 Dodge Coronet? A: The 1968 Dodge Coronet has lengths of 206.60 and 210.00 inches. Q: What is the width of the 1968 Dodge Coronet? A: The 1968 Dodge Coronet has a width of 76.70 inches. Q: How much did the 1968 Dodge Coronet cost when new?A: The 1968 Dodge Coronet cost approximately $2,460 to $3,610 (USD) when.
